Snowflake Obsidian - Tower gravel After some work hammering itMined from: Utah, USA Description: Snowflake Obsidian is a type of volcanic glass known for its striking black appearance with white, snowflake like patterns. The patterns are created by the inclusion of a crystalline mineral called cristobalite, which forms as the obsidian cools. Cristobalite is a high temperature polymorph of silica (silicon dioxide), meaning it has the same chemical composition as quartz (SiO) but a different crystal structure.
